Transaction 505211c151f194dbb64e40aa464e61d6e404ddf32a6c4dee6156772f4149fd80
1 Input
2 Outputs
- 505211c151f194dbb64e40aa464e61d6e404ddf32a6c4dee6156772f4149fd80:0
- 505211c151f194dbb64e40aa464e61d6e404ddf32a6c4dee6156772f4149fd80:1
value 44559
address 1KxTaZb6eDiBMHVdGuSxVE7MWHfcdMNT26
value 1501540
address 3H61giTmfQhpv7W1XyYuF5uoMAK9fS1VC2